In this episode of the Torch Mom Podcast, host Tia Lilley dives into an essential conversation for every parent: how to manage stress, release worry, and renew ourselves in order to show up better for our children. Tia explores the impact of modeling healthy emotional practices for our kids and discusses the importance of handling stress in a way that aligns with the strength and peace we want to instill in them. Drawing from personal insight and spiritual direction, she highlights three powerful concepts, Removing, Releasing, and Renewing, that can help us rediscover balance and presence in our busy lives. Tune in for a refreshing perspective on how to prioritize your own well-being while being the best version of yourself for your family.
